Keep runs outside the 09:00–11:00 window, since the Marlowe warehouse locks the recipient tables then and partial reads produce duplicate digests. Set DIGEST_BATCH_SIZE conservatively (500 is safe) until you've confirmed throughput on staging. Timezone handling follows DIGEST_TZ, not the host clock — double-check this before your first deploy. Finally, the digest sender authenticates to the outbound relay, and the next line in the env file provides that credential.

secret setting of yajog-taguf: ARCHIVE_KEY3=051

**Q: A customer says the new consent banner keeps reappearing. What should I tell them?**

The Glimmerbank consent banner rollout is staged by region, and preferences are stored per device, not per account. Clearing cookies or switching browsers will re-trigger the banner; this is expected. If the banner reappears within the same session, collect the customer's region and browser version, then forward the case to the privacy rollout team at the address below.

escalation mailbox, hadug-bajog: sormir@norvalabs.internal

**Vendor note: Inkmill markdown pipeline**

Rendering for Parchway docs is outsourced to Inkmill under an annual contract, renewing each March. They handle sanitization and PDF export; we own the upload queue. SLA: 4-hour response on rendering failures. Escalate only after two failed retries. Their support desk is reachable at the address below.

billing contact of hahaf-baguf = zorael.tammir.jorius@sivrelhq.internal

Severity: High. Affects external plugins registered against the post-rotation hook.

Repro steps:
1. Register a plugin with a post-rotation hook via the Keyspin CLI.
2. Trigger rotation for a vault containing one revoked entry.
3. Observe rotation completes for valid entries, but hooks never fire and no error surfaces to the plugin.

Expected: hooks fire for successful rotations; failures reported per-entry. To reproduce against the sandbox vault, authenticate your plugin using the bearer token below.

login token, bagug-kafop: eyJhbGciOiJIUzI1NiIsInR5cCI6IkpXVCJ9.eyJzdWIiOiIcMLov2In0.Z5RLDIfp